All employees who have taken the special attrition package will have to be out of the plant no later than July 22, 2007 to be eligible for any type of training (HCTC), healthcare tax credit or any other benefits.  The employees who chose the buyout should return to the Career Transition Center at 4257 Dryden Rd.  Moraine, Ohio 45439, or call (937) 496-7397 or (937) 496-7398.  The employees who chose to retire should contact the job center at Edwin C. Moses Blvd. Dayton, Ohio 45422 or call 1-800-251-6237.   Because you retired, you are eligible for the same benefits. This petition, TA-W-57, 754 will expire August 22, 2007.   It will take the state at least four weeks to place a dislocated worker into some type of program.
